ITEM 12 TERRITORY
Franchise Agreement
You will operate the Cost Cutters Store at an approved location, and that approved location may be in a Walmart store. You may operate the Cost Cutters Store only at the site we approve. You receive no territorial rights. You may not relocate the Cost Cutters Store. Cost Cutters reserves the right to offer Cost Cutters franchises at approved locations outside Walmart stores. You will not receive an exclusive territory. You may face competition from other franchisees, from outlets that we own, or from other channels of distribution or competitive brands that we control.
You do not receive an exclusive territory or area when granted a single Cost Cutters franchise.

What This Means (2024 FDD)
According to the 2024 Cost Cutters Family Hair Salon Franchise Disclosure Document, franchisees are not permitted to relocate their store. The FDD states that a franchisee must operate their Cost Cutters Family Hair Salon at a location that Cost Cutters Family Hair Salon approves.
This restriction means that franchisees cannot independently decide to move their business to a different location, even if they believe it would be more profitable. The initial site selection is critical, as the franchisee is bound to that specific location unless Cost Cutters Family Hair Salon approves an exception, which is not guaranteed. This lack of flexibility could pose a challenge if the area around the approved location deteriorates economically or if a better opportunity arises elsewhere.
Furthermore, the document specifies that Cost Cutters Family Hair Salon reserves the right to offer franchises at locations outside Walmart stores. The franchisee will operate their Cost Cutters Family Hair Salon at a site that Cost Cutters Family Hair Salon first accepts and will sublease that site from their affiliate unless Cost Cutters Family Hair Salon approves a location outside of a Walmart store, in which case, they may require the franchisee to lease directly from the landlord. This highlights the importance of thoroughly researching and understanding the location approval process and the terms of the lease agreement before committing to a Cost Cutters Family Hair Salon franchise.
